摘要
Results of a new spectroscopic survey for damped Lyalpha absorption systems conducted at ultraviolet wavelengths are combined with those of previous surveys conducted at optical wavelengths in order to examine the evolution of the gaseous content of the universe at 0 less than or similar to z less than or similar to 3.5. Implications for scenarios of galaxy formation and evolution are discussed.
